In order to care better for cattle health, the Andhra Pradesh government is launching the Andhra Pradesh Cattle health card scheme 2021. The YSR, through the implementation of this scheme, will offer Andhra Pradesh health cards to all eligible beneficiaries. Families that have been identified in the state through the Livestock census would be able to benefit from the scheme and can apply for the Cattle health card.

To run the scheme perfectly well, the state government has allocated ₹50 crores. 

The scheme would be implemented with the help of village volunteers who are available at Rythu Bharosa Kendras, present all across the state. 

What the scheme covers?

The scheme offers all cattle health-related services such as deworming, breeding, Brucellosis vaccination, foot and mouth disease control, Entertoxemia disease (ETD) control, and even sheep packs would be covered under the scheme.

The vaccination and deworming program will be conducted twice each year across the state. In this scheme, the state government will also compensate for the loss of cattle under the YSR livestock losses compensation scheme. 

The Andhra Pradesh government will distribute Animal health cards to livestock owners so as to maintain the record of livestock and extend services to farmers. The Animal card will be useful to get compensation from the state government. People can even check the Andhra Pradesh health card scheme application process to find out more about the benefits.
